1. Hardware Gauntlet, Your First Non-Negotiable Step
Before you even consider `windows 11 kaufen`, you have to meet the Windows 11 hardware requirements (TPM 2.0 Secure Boot modern CPU). Windows 7-based computers, especially older than 2017, aren’t able to pass this test. This isn’t a Microsoft money grab, it’s an important security mandate. These features are the “hardware roots of trust” that modern defenses such as Windows Defender, and even third-party security products such as Kaspersky Premium, rely. Unofficial ISO modifications could create an unstable system that’s unsupportable and nullifies any security benefits. This leaves you even more vulnerable to attacks more than Windows 7.
2. License migration myth Windows 7 Keys are (mostly) outdated.
The past was when you could often make use of the Windows 7 Pro key to activate Windows 10. Windows 11 does not have this grace period. Windows 7 OEM licenses, as well as those that are tied to motherboards from the past are no longer valid for Windows 11 installations on older hardware. It’s a new beginning. You are searching for “windows 11 license” is a brand new purchase. You will need to understand the retail as well as. OEM landscape.

6. The Professional Feature Crossroads: Pro is the New Minimum.
Windows 11 pro is necessary if Windows 7 Professional has been used to host Remote Desktop, BitLocker and domain join. This is a blunder you should avoid for commercial or professional use. Home does not support BitLocker as well as has no Group Policy editor and it is not able to join domains. Windows 11 Pro is only available as an Microsoft 365 Business or Retail license for Windows 7 Pro users. This lets them maintain their professional features and data security.

3. The Compliance & Audit Time Bomb for companies.
Unlicensed businesses are playing Russian Roulette using audits. When a business uses a Windows server 2025 with the correct cals, but client PCs run grey-market Windows versions and an audit is conducted, the company will receive a “true-up invoice” for the full retail cost on each illegitimate license plus potential penalties. It is an unexpected capital expenditure that is not budgeted and can reach tens of thousands of dollars, utterly outweighing any prior “savings.” A valid license serves as an insurance policy to safeguard you from this financial shock.
